What Matters Most

Network type (HMO, PPO, EPO) determines both your premium and your out-of-pocket costs. An HMO saves $100-200/month in premiums but restricts you to in-network providers only.

Pro Tip

If you're self-employed or buying individual coverage, always check ACA marketplace plans — subsidies are income-based and can reduce a $600/month premium to $100-200.

Common Mistake

Choosing the cheapest plan without calculating total annual cost (premiums + deductible + copays). A $300/month plan with a $6,000 deductible often costs more annually than a $500/month plan with a $1,000 deductible.

Best Time to Buy

Open enrollment runs November 1 - January 15. Missing this window limits you to qualifying life events or short-term plans that don't cover pre-existing conditions.

Detailed Cost Breakdown

Health Insurance Cost Items — Odessa

Adjusted for Odessa
13 cost items — hover rows for details
ItemLow Est.High Est.Note
Bronze plan (marketplace)
$191$382per month (high deductible)
Silver plan (marketplace)
$267$497per month (moderate)
Gold plan (marketplace)
$344$611per month (lower copays)
Employer-sponsored (employee share)
$76$306per month
Family plan premium
$382$1,529per month
Annual deductible (individual)
$1,146$6,114before insurance pays
Out-of-pocket maximum
$3,821$6,878per year
Copay (primary care visit)
$20$50per visit
Copay (specialist visit)
$30$75per visit
Prescription drug tier 1 (generic)
$5$20per fill
Prescription drug tier 3 (specialty)
$38$153per fill
Dental add-on plan
$15$46per month
Vision add-on plan
$8$19per month
13 items listed · All prices in USDData verified March 2026
